What We Offer
- Food Pantry
Our pantry is stocked with essential items to help families facing food insecurity.
Open the 1st & 3rd Wednesday of each month
- Uniform Assistance
Free uniform items available for Wilson students in need — including shirts, pants, and outerwear.
- Family Support Services
We offer connections to local services for housing, utilities, employment, mental health, and more. Let us help you navigate challenges with care and confidentiality.
- Workshops & Resources
Throughout the year, we host parent education classes, community partner events, and opportunities to learn about wellness, parenting, and student success.
